R - the type of object to materialize.public class Materializer<R> extends Object implements java.util.function.Function<InputSource,R>
| Constructor and Description |
|---|
Materializer(int initialPoolSize,
java.util.function.Supplier<FlatTag<? super R>> rootTagSupplier,
java.util.function.Supplier<R> rootItemSupplier) |
Materializer(Schema schema,
int initialPoolSize,
java.util.function.Supplier<FlatTag<? super R>> rootTagSupplier,
java.util.function.Supplier<R> rootItemSupplier) |
Materializer(java.util.function.Supplier<FlatTag<? super R>> rootTagSupplier,
java.util.function.Supplier<R> rootItemSupplier) |
| Modifier and Type | Method and Description |
|---|---|
R |
apply(InputSource inputSource) |
static Schema |
getSchemas(String... uris) |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itandThen, compose, identitypublic Materializer(java.util.function.Supplier<FlatTag<? super R>> rootTagSupplier, java.util.function.Supplier<R> rootItemSupplier)
public Materializer(int initialPoolSize,
java.util.function.Supplier<FlatTag<? super R>> rootTagSupplier,
java.util.function.Supplier<R> rootItemSupplier)
public Materializer(Schema schema, int initialPoolSize, java.util.function.Supplier<FlatTag<? super R>> rootTagSupplier, java.util.function.Supplier<R> rootItemSupplier)
public R apply(InputSource inputSource)
apply in interface java.util.function.Function<InputSource,R>Copyright © 2021. All rights reserved.